My boyfriend and I celebrated our anniversary here last Saturday (4/2), and we were swooning over the savory and everlasting flavors. We still cannot stop talking about the food.The service was rocky, truth be told, but Kristine’s was quick to recover their mistakes-this did not go unnoticed. Our reservation was for 7:15, and we arrived 5 minutes ahead of time for check-in. Yet, we were seated after a 7:30 reservation instead-we waited well past our time for an open table. The manager quickly noticed and offered us our first round of drinks on them.Drinks were superb, whiskey cocktails and wine. We waited roughly a half-hour for the appetizer, which was well beyond worth it. The mussels were large and beyond flavorful, lord. The sauce resembled a creamy carbonara/ Alfredo but 10000% better! Paired with crispy salty fries-we were starstruck.Following the entree, our meal came out 2 hours after being seated, lol. Literally 2 hours, at 9:40. Because of this, our appetizer and another round of drinks were generously comped. The entrees were delicious and savory, mouthwatering- dismissing the 2-hour dreadful wait.Although the restaurant was generous enough to comp parts of our meal, it was still hard to move over the matter of 2 and half hour sit down dinner from the start (waiting to be seated) to finishing the check... We purposely came out to Princeton to go to Bent Spoon across the street, but by the time our entrees came out, we asked for the check as plates were placed on the table. By the time the check was brought back, it was 9:55, and it was too late to get our Bent Spoon as they closed at 10 pm. The experience was fantastic minus the hungry period, but in all honesty, we will be returning.
